One of the newest and largest Colleges within the University of Oxford, St Catherine’s is looking for a Communications and Marketing Officer. This is a crucial role which offers an exciting opportunity to promote the College to a wide variety of people.
The Communications & Marketing Officer will play a key role in supporting the Head of Communications and Marketing to develop and deliver strategic, creative, and impactful communications for St Catz. Working across digital and print channels, the post-holder will help bring the College’s stories to life – showcasing its academic excellence, vibrant community, and distinctive architecture and spirit to internal and external audiences.
They will assist in implementing the College’s communications and marketing plan, managing day-to-day activity across web, email, and social media, producing engaging content, and supporting campaigns and publications. The role will also help to ensure the consistency and quality of the College’s communications, contribute to brand development, and evaluate the impact of activity.
You will have excellent literacy, communication and IT skills, together with an ability to interact with people at all levels and from all backgrounds. An active interest in e-communications and marketing is essential. You will be expected to manage competing demands on your time successfully, have an eye for detail, and work well by yourself and as part of a small team.
The salary is within the range of £29,588 - £33,951 per annum, dependent upon skills and experience, comprising 35 hours per week. In addition, benefits include 30 days annual leave, free lunches, free use of the College gym and a season ticket loan scheme for travel.
